From 95caf70dd122c3ea783b35de2b33102048b4de67 Mon Sep 17 00:00:00 2001 From: tastytea Date: Mon, 16 Jan 2023 19:45:30 +0100 Subject: [PATCH] www-apps/misskey: fix pnpm wrapper and install node_modules --- www-apps/misskey/misskey-13.0.0.ebuild |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/www-apps/misskey/misskey-13.0.0.ebuild b/www-apps/misskey/misskey-13.0.0.ebuild index 0d2d8f8..d889bc3 100644 --- a/www-apps/misskey/misskey-13.0.0.ebuild +++ b/www-apps/misskey/misskey-13.0.0.ebuild @@ -58,8 +58,8 @@ QA_PREBUILT=" pnpm() { # use the pnpm from nodejs if it isn't available otherwise - if type pnpm > /dev/null 2>&1; then - pnpm "${@}" + if [[ -x /usr/bin/pnpm ]] > /dev/null 2>&1; then + /usr/bin/pnpm "${@}" else /usr/$(get_libdir)/node_modules/corepack/dist/pnpm.js "${@}" fi @@ -105,7 +105,7 @@ src_install() { if use source; then doins -r . else - doins -r package.json .node-version .config built packages + doins -r package.json .node-version .config built node_modules packages fi # insopts doesn't affect directories